It may have a short-term benefit for SEs like Google who can be skeptical at first of dynamic pages. But once it indexes your pages, the benefit of static HTML vs. dynamic is not worth it compared to the benefits of dynamic pages (site maintenance, for example).
I'd think more about what's better for your site first, then if all is equal perhaps making the pages static HTML. |
